Skip to content

[bug] Remote track not properly listened joining a room the second time #907

@emanueltesoriello

Description

@emanueltesoriello

The problem

  1. Join to a room where other remote participants are already in
  2. disconnect and dispose from the room
  3. reconnect again to the same room (still the other participants are there)
  4. you can see them, but not they're video and the tracks events are not properly propagated

Forcing a full app and SDK restart make everything works again.

Expected behavior
Joining the second time would have the same behaviour as first time!

Platform information
Flutter SDK version: Android/iOS

  • Flutter version:
    Flutter 3.35.6 • channel stable • https://github.com/flutter/flutter.git
    Framework • revision 9f455d2486 (3 weeks ago) • 2025-10-08 14:55:31 -0500
    Engine • hash a5f2c36e367c13f868cfe98db5806f562c52c35e (revision d2913632a4) (24 days ago) • 2025-10-07 17:26:21.000Z
    Tools • Dart 3.9.2 • DevTools 2.48.0

  • Plugin version: 2.5.3

  • Flutter target OS: Any

  • Flutter target OS version: Any

  • Flutter console log:

Metadata

Metadata

Assignees

Labels

bugSomething isn't working

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ions